PaediaSure® Peptide
PaediaSure® Peptide is a complete, balanced, partially hydrolysed feed for children weighing 8 - 30 kg.
Indications
PaediaSure®Peptide is suitable for children with:
- Impaired gastrointestinal tolerance
- Maldigestion and Malabsorption
- Gastro-oesophageal reflux disease
- Motility disorders
- Post gastrointestinal surgery
- Short bowel syndrome
- Inflammatory bowel disease
- Cystic Fibrosis
- Pancreatic disorders
- Chronic diarrhoea
- Inability to tolerate polymeric (standard) feeds

**Nutritionally complete for vitamins and minerals in 778ml for children aged 1-3 years, 1111ml for children aged 4-6 ears and 1667ml for children aged 7-10 years (excluding electrolytes, calculated using the UK Reference Nutrient Intake for these age bands).

Note
- Not suitable for children under 1 year of age
- Not suitable for children with galactosaemia
- FOR ENTERAL USE ONLY
